La Crosse Technology WT-5442 Clock Radio User Manual


 
A. PROGRAMMING SEQUENCE
Default (Factory) Setting
1. Time Zone Setting -5 (eastern standard time)
2. Daylight Saving Time ON/OFF ON
3. Adjustable Snooze 10 Minutes
4. Hour Setting 12: AM
5. Minute Setting :00
6. Year Setting 01 (2001)
7. Month Setting 1 (January)
8. Date Setting 1
9. Day Setting MO (Monday)
10. 12/24-hour Mode 12-hour
B. FUNCTION BUTTONS
There are 8 function buttons; three on the
front, four on the back and one on the top of
the projection alarm. The function buttons
are labeled: ALM1/HOUR, ALM2/MIN, light
intensity icon, DISPL, light direction icon,
SET, MODE/+, and SNOOZE (the top bar).
C. TIME ZONE SETTING
1. Hold down the “SET” button for 1 second, the time zone (“-5” default)
will flash in the Date LCD.
2. Press and release the “Mode/+” button to select the appropriate time
zone. There are 13 time zones to choose from based relative to the
international time standard of GMT (“Greenwich Mean Time”)(shown
as “0h” on display).
3. From –5h to –8h, a US map with the highlighted time zone will also be
displayed to the right of the time display.
4. Press and release the “SET” button to confirm the time zone setting,
and to advance to DST (Daylight saving time) setting.
-4h Atlantic Time
-5h Eastern Time (default setting)
-6h Central Time
-7h Mountain Time
-8h Pacific Time
-9h Alaskan Time
-10h Hawaiian Time
-11h, -12h Next two time zones West of HAW
0h Greenwich Mean Time
-1h, -2h, -3h Three time zones West of GMT
